Movies and Cybersecurity
Realism is often overlooked when making a film or a movie. Cybersecurity is a topic of film that fits this description as many technological events are not conducted in a proper manner. In the movie Skyfall, a group of digital forensics or security analysts are working to hack into a system by directly connecting to the device; while doing so, they fail to adhere to best practices when working with an unknown device by not checking for risks. In the films The Matrix Reloaded, scenes of hacking are often rushed and lack the complexity of surveying the environment. These films often simplify hacking and make it appear that little effort is needed to gain entry to a system. When people view these films, their interpretation of cybersecurity is how simple it might be to compromise a system and how hacking can be conducted very quickly. This makes people underestimate the defense and hardening capabilities devices have.
